“We stayed in 'King Room' which was big enough. The check-in and -out processes went nicely and smoothly. The room was clean and we were provided with sufficient quantity of toiletries. There is enough space in the parking lot. Gas station is just across the street. Staff is friendly and welcoming. Breakfast is served from 5am through 9am on weekdays and from 6am through 10am on weekends and holidays. Tap water is good for human consumption, and we had coffee machine in our room. It's a good location for visitors of Death Valley National Park who want to take an overnight stay nearby.”
